#mainblock table.pricetable {margin: 9px 0; width: 100%; background: #123862;}
#mainblock table.pricetable td {vertical-align: top; text-align: left; font: 1.2em/1.1em Verdana,sans-serif; color: black; padding: 4px 9px; background: white; }
#mainblock table.pricetable p {vertical-align: top; text-align: left; font: 1.2em/1.1em Verdana,sans-serif; color: black; padding: 4px 9px; background: white; }
#mainblock table.pricetable td a {display: inline; text-align: left; font: 1.0em Verdana,sans-serif; color: #123862; padding: 0 0 0 0px; margin: auto 0 auto 0px; text-decoration: none; }
#mainblock table.pricetable td a:hover {text-decoration: underline;}
#mainblock table.pricetable td span {color: gray; }
#mainblock table.pricetable th { background: #123862; padding: 3px; color:white; text-align: center; font: bold 1.2em/1.1em Verdana,sans-serif; text-transform:capitalize;}
.pricechange					{width: 100%; background-color: #EEF6FF ! important; font-weight: bold;}